全部面经94
精选
|
最新
岗位:
展开
城市:
展开
关键词:
展开
已选:
iOS(93)
清空已选条件
自由港铁皮柜执行制片人
未通过
面试:iOS。较糟糕的面试体验,难度由浅入深,告知没通过。
字节跳动(北京)抖音的iOS视频面试。2022.8月份进行了只给了题,怕自己的答案不准确,所以不给答案了。首先自我介绍。他会询问一些项目中的内容。开始技术问题:1.内存管理 简述一下。在回答的时候,可能会提到自动释放池,面试官追问在什么地方用到自动释放池。自动释放池原理2.局部变量的内存上如何存储的?3.页面间传值,可以使用什么方法。(这个页面传值有逻辑关系,点击某个按钮,不相关的其他页面的某个值发生变化,这时候页面传值怎么写)4.weak修饰的属性在category的内部是如何实现的?5.@property的属性在不同线程调用,安全问题,会出现什么问题。其实atomic修饰,是否就是线程安全的,具体为什么6.崩溃有几种类型,具体都有什么7.线上崩溃问题如何抓取?如果回答是三方(友盟,bugly)或者是解析dSYM,会追问解析出来代码不认识,乱码,如何解决8.Copy 简述一下作用9.谈谈你对代理和block的理解,分别有什么优缺点,分别在什么情况下选用。延伸问题:oc的多继承都怎么实现10.说说oc的消息发送和转发机制11.说说响应者链12.说一下认为比较成功的项目,项目中某个具体功能如何实现的,要比较细节的系统的描述。最后的笔试题:给出两个View,View1和View2,找出他们的第一个共同superView。在线写代码。部分题没有记住,整体来说是面试官首先会问一个比较常见的问题,然后根据你的回答,逐渐延伸深度
1轮面试:视频面试
面试感受:不好;面试难度:困难;面试来源:社会招聘
2023-01-16发布
2276
确定通过
iOS面试不好,共1轮面试
1.OSI七层模型和五层模型,每层模型的作用具体说一下。2.TCP和UDP属于那个层的?3.既然说到了传输层,那你给我讲一下四次挥手的过程,越详细越好。4.网页输入url到浏览器显示页面的过程。5.你能说一下传回的数据包怎么显示在浏览器页面的过程吗?(内心OS:这不前端干的吗?)硬说的HTML被解析构建DOM树,CSS构建了渲染树,然后布局绘制在屏幕上。6.刚才说到四次挥手,你说说close-wait 和 time-wait左右,time-wait会导致什么问题,刚才为什么说是2MSL?
1轮面试:视频面试
面试感受:不好;面试难度:困难;面试来源:BOSS直聘
2 年前发布
匿名用户
未通过
2 年前发布
5
匿名用户
确定通过
【iOS】面试分享
第一轮技术面,面的都是技术方面的知识,因为是电商平台,所以更多是问计网方面的知识,例如:http1.0与2.0的区别,QUIC了解过吗?DNS查询过程等等,然后就是iOS的一些基础知识,你自己用过的第三方库的原理是否看过?然后跨平台方面RN与Flutter的区别,最后再是算法题
3轮面试:视频面试、笔试、协作同事面试
面试感受:一般;面试难度:有难度;面试来源:社会招聘
2 年前发布
7752
确定通过
iOS面试很好,共1轮面试
第一轮技术面,面的都是技术方面的知识,因为是电商平台,所以更多是问计网方面的知识,例如:http1.0与2.0的区别,QUIC了解过吗?DNS查询过程等等,然后就是iOS的一些基础知识,你自己用过的第三方库的原理是否看过?然后跨平台方面RN与Flutter的区别,最后再是算法题
1轮面试:视频面试
面试感受:很好;面试难度:简单;面试来源:猎头推荐
2 年前发布
匿名用户
感觉靠谱
一面通过,等待二面中
视频面试,首先自我介绍,围绕项目问了一些小问题。然后就是一些常规性的底层实现原理,难度不算特别高,不过还是需要提前准备。然后出了一些读代码的题,比较有误导性,答得一般,有一道block中将self置为空的题比较考验runtime的理解。最后是一道手写算法题,想出来的思路和最佳解决策略略有差距。还是应该再好好准备一下啊。
1轮面试:视频面试
面试感受:很好;面试难度:有难度;面试来源:社会招聘
共1个问题,1条回答
Q:@implementation TestObj - (void)testMethod { if (self.block) { self.block(); } NSLog(@"%@", self); } @end int main(int argc, const char * argv[]) { @autoreleasepool { __block TestObj *testObj = [TestObj new]; testObj.block = ^{ testObj = nil; }; [testObj testMethod]; } return 0; } 执行结果?
2 年前发布
3
匿名用户
感觉靠谱
3轮,感觉挺好。
3轮技术,没一轮都有算法题。像基本的block weak 分类原理都问了,网络重点放在了http。另外问了moch-o内部结构。面试官会按照你的简历慢慢深挖,这感觉很好,你不会的老实说,你会的他会扩展。
面试感受:很好;面试难度:普通难度
2 年前发布
iOS
确定通过
2 年前发布
扫码登录
微信扫码登录
查看更多结果
本页面内容均为用户编辑创建,如有侵权,请按照平台提供的渠道通知。
内容索引
优秀公司
推荐公司
最新公司
相似公司
-
小程序
-
公众号
-
APP